The largest container shipping alliance in the world, 2M Alliance has announced several schedule changes in the next weeks.
Due to the ongoing challenging market situation generating congestion and schedule delays across the supply chain, the alliance of Maersk and MSC is planning the following sailing omissions:

MSC said that its customers may continue to place bookings as usual as the company is arranging a contingency plan with alternative services.
Additionally, the 2M Alliance has decided to reinstate the ports of Newark and Savannah on the America and Liberty services respectively.

To support these reinstatements and maintain operational efficiency, the second Newark call on the Empire service will be temporarily removed. Below are the adjustment details:

“These changes are part of the alliance’s continuous review of service and vessel rotations according to market needs,” said MSC in a statement.
